TSCO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

967 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Tractor Supply (TSCO)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$17.5B — down 2.2% from $17.9B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 103 funds closed out of TSCO and 90 opened new positions — a net loss of 13 holders — while 358 trimmed existing stakes and 350 added.

The largest buyer was Ontario Teachers' Pension Plan Board, adding an estimated $311M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$191M.
